Highland Park Recap

Highland Park Champions
While LD, PF, and Congress debaters we busy at Edina, our Policy debaters were competing at Highland Park.  Anne and Sukriti took down the varsity championship.  Anne also earned 5th place speaker honors while Sukriti was 2nd speaker.

The novice debaters were also champions.  Lily and Elsa were undefeated and Lily was 2nd speaker.

Dani and Maggie

And a shout out to Maggie for taking Dani, a novice, into varsity as her partner for the weekend.  Maggie spent the weekend teaching and coaching her partner, making her more prepared for hard debates to come yet this season.  It's an example of the many instances of selfless leadership that are becoming the norm on our team.
